Output d98dfe90a1a53c8737c7e3e66c6a6911aa07d9ba77b09b9bdbe4dbef20eaab79:1

value
76564492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ad1b2572bba44dda49e4c5db21584dbb109bf35 OP_EQUAL
address
MHdy4k1b5u9FHcNbKYsDzpKs7rvWrYb84e
transaction
d98dfe90a1a53c8737c7e3e66c6a6911aa07d9ba77b09b9bdbe4dbef20eaab79
spent
true